Serving size, prep, and portion notes for barley groats
Barley groats are barley in its least-processed edible form: only the inedible outer hull has been taken off, leaving the bran and the germ on the kernel. That is what separates them from pearl barley, which has been tumbled against abrasive surfaces until the bran is polished away. Groats take forty minutes to an hour to soften and stay firm and chewy, and they are the version that turns up in whole-grain salads, soups and grain bowls. Their trigger profile is unusually narrow. This is a food with exactly two problems: it is a gluten grain, so coeliac disease rules it out outright, and it is high in fructans and rated high FODMAP. Outside those two, we grade barley groats clean across the board, on histamine, histamine liberation, salicylates, oxalate, nickel, lectins, glutamates, tyramine, sulfites and dairy protein, and it grades well on small-intestinal fermentation too. If you are chasing something other than gluten or FODMAPs, the whole barley kernel is rarely your culprit.
Watch for
A gluten grain, which the packaging rarely says loudly. Hulled barley is sold in the ancient-grain and wholefood bins right next to quinoa, millet and buckwheat, which are all gluten free, and it is the one in that row that is not / High in fructans and rated high FODMAP, so the portion is the variable that matters. A scattering through a salad and a full grain-bowl base are different exposures / Fructans are water soluble, so in a long-simmered soup or broth they leach out into the liquid. Fishing the grain out of the bowl does not give you a low FODMAP soup / Clean on histamine, salicylates, oxalate, nickel, lectins, glutamates and sulfites, which makes it a useful control food when you are trying to isolate a non-gluten trigger / Rich in beta-glucan soluble fibre, so a sudden jump from refined grains to whole barley commonly brings a week or two of wind before the gut settles
